Recent Form + Tactical Duel
Érdi VSE’s last 5: mixed but positive with wins like 1-0 at MTK II and 3-2 at Paks II, averaging 1.4 goals scored, solid away but home control expected (6W overall). Dombóvári catastrophic: 5 straight losses (0-4 Paks II, 1-4 Pénzügyőr, 0-3 Ferencvárosi II), 0 wins all season, just 16 goals in 22 games. Tactically, Érdi will dominate possession (55% avg) with 4-2-3-1 build-up from midfield pivots, exploiting Dombóvári’s porous defense via left-wing breakthroughs—Dombó rely on desperate long balls/counters that rarely click, leading to a controlled home affair.
